zoukankan      html  css  js  c++  java
  • linux系统执行.exe文件

    首先要了解一下Wine:

    Wine (“Wine Is Not an Emulator” 的首字母缩写)是一个能够在多种 POSIX-compliant 操作系统(诸如 Linux,Mac OSX 及 BSD 等)上运行 Windows 应用的兼容层。

    那么安装wine就可以了。

    1、安装需要的软件包:

    yum groupinstall 'Development Tools'           //安装开发工具,耗时较长
    yum install libX11-devel freetype-devel zlib-devel libxcb-devel     //安装开发工具库

    2、下载并解压Wine包

    下载地址:https://sourceforge.net/projects/wine/files/Source/ 各个版本都有,这里直接在linux中下载
    cd /usr/src //下载文件的目录,可自行选择
    wget https://excellmedia.dl.sourceforge.net/project/wine/Source/wine-3.7.tar.xz //下载
    tar -xvJf ./wine-3.7.tar.xz //解压

    3、安装wine,耗时很长很长,30分钟以上

    cd wine-3.7

    64位安装方法:注意是三条命令

    ./configure -enable-win64
    
    make
    
    make install

    32位安装方法:注意是三条命令

    ./configure
    
    make
    
    make install

    如果缺包,导致执行./configure --enable-win64报错,执行以下命令后解决了:

    yum install flex.x86_64
    
    yum install bison.x86_64

    注意:安装时间会比较长,耐心等待。

    4、安装成功后,用 wine 命令,检测:

    32位系统

    wine –version

    64位系统

    wine64 –version

    centos7.0成功安装wine无法使用,执行以下命令试试:

    sudo ln -s /usr/local/bin/wine64 /usr/local/bin/wine

    5、Wine怎么用

    使用如下命令运行你的程序,有些程序可能需要root权限:

    wine xxx.exe

     若出现:

    wine: Bad EXE format for Z:DLYServererl7.3.exe.

    是你的.exe文件不是64的问题

  • 相关阅读:
    团队开发冲刺2.3(2015.5.27)
    团队开发冲刺2.2(2015.5.26)
    团队开发冲刺2.1(2015.5.26)
    团队开发冲刺1.6(2015.5.14)
    团队开发冲刺1.5(2015.5.13)
    团队开发冲刺1.4(2015.5.12)
    团队开发冲刺1.3(2015.5.11)
    团队开发冲刺1.2(2015.5.10)
    团队开发冲刺1.1(2015.5.9)
    找1
  • 原文地址:https://www.cnblogs.com/zeussbook/p/11008667.html
Copyright © 2011-2022 走看看